Monday, April 15, 1994. Miguel "MG" Gonzalez gets a $400 payday loan from his neighborhood check cashing spot so he can buy the 27-inch TV he's been fantasizing about for days.

Two weeks later, while straightening out a few wrinkled green bills for the rent, he realizes his payday loan is also due.

A month later, "MG" has moved back to his parent's house. Lying down on his childhood bed, squinting at Sammy Sosa at bat on a tiny black-and-white TV, he hears his mother call out: "Mijo, ¿cómo funciona el remote? ¡No entra mi novela!"
